Many people still remember the collapse of the CIA's intelligence network in China in those years. From 2010 to 2012, China's security departments made rapid moves, directly arresting or executing at least 18 informants suspected of providing intelligence to the United States. These people are mostly hidden in government departments and key enterprises, and are responsible for transmitting confidential documents and sensitive data.

As a result, the intelligence gathering work in the United States suddenly collapsed, and it couldn't slow down for several years. The new york Times reported this incident in 2017, saying that it was one of the worst failures in the history of American intelligence. After those informants were arrested, the CIA assessed internally that their network in China was basically completely destroyed, and it took a lot of effort to rebuild it.
